A parasite is a type of (1 point) carnivore. filter feeder. symbiont. detritivore.
skad [1K]
A parasite is a type of a symbiont. 
Parasitism describes a relationship between two organisms where one benefits, and the other is harmed. The parasite is the organism that benefits from the relationship, while the host is harmed by the relationship. Parasites can be a number of things including plants, animals and even viruses and bacteria.

The central portion of an intervertebral disc is the ________.
Aleks04 [339]
The center portion of each intervertebral disc is a filled with a gel-like elastic substance. Together with the annulus fibrosis, the nucleus pulposus transmits stress and weight from vertebra to vertebra.
